Enhance Existing Production Capacity without the complete EC process with No Increase in Pollution Load Certificate As per GO issued by MoEF&CC on 2 March, 2022, industries (listed against sector 2,3,4,5 – Coal washeries, Mineral Beneficiation, Metallurgical Industries, Cement plants, Distilleries, Sugar plants etc. as per Schedule of EIA Notification, 2006) have the opportunity to increase the existing production capacity as per the EC granted by up to 50% without having to go through the entire EIA process again. Note: This Provision is only for the project/Activity granted EC as per EIA- 1994/2006.

  2. No Increase in Pollution Load (NIPL) Provision: Conditions The conditions that need to be met when applying for expansion under the No Increase in Pollution Load provision are – The pollution load should not be increased No new equipment/ machinery to be added as compared to EC granted. Installation and implementation of Online Continuous Monitoring System (OCMS) with at least 95% uptime, connected to the servers of the Central Pollution Control Board and State Pollution Control Board to report the quantity and quality of emission and discharges is mandatory. ● ● ● This can be achieved with or without any change in (i) raw material-mix or (ii) product-mix or (iii) quantities within products or (iv) number of products including new products falling in the same category or (v) configuration of the plant or process or operations in existing area or in areas contiguous to the existing area. How does it benefit you? Before these exemptions, whether or not expansions of any magnitude required to go through the entire EC process again. Now, this won’t be necessary for the sectors listed in the notification and for expansion up to 50% of existing capacity as per EC (% allowed may vary depending on the project). Application Process: You can apply under NIPL provision by registering through PARIVESH, an online portal. If you are an already registered user, you can log in with your username and password. If are not a registered user, you can register by selecting the project proponent/user agency. You have to continue filling in the details and documents as required. Once your user login is complete, you have to select ‘intimation concerning NIPL’. Additionally, select the appropriate responses to the questions posed and upload any necessary supporting documentation. Once all the details are filled and appropriate documents are attached, you need to accept the undertaking and then click to view the acknowledgment. It is advised that you carefully read your acknowledgment before clicking the download button.
